Quote:
Originally Posted by NikFu S.
I use them at night here in areas where there are no street lights. They improve ground visibility quite a bit, and the roads here can be quite hazardous with terrain and wild animals popping out everywhere.

I completely disagree with what you think they do to the image. It's completely illogical.
Actually it's quite logical. Both early to mid 90s Saturns and Ford Thunderbirds have headlight assemblies that have two points of light on each side, and they're kinda narrow together. the light is diffused through the early 90s fluting on the lense.. Hence, using hte foglights illuminutes the fluting on the lense and is slightly and it's close to the center of hte car. the projectors on the other hand, are highly concentrated points of light that only expensive imported cars have. if you use fogs, you're using the same lighting system as a saturn. or a thunderbird. or countless other pieces of crap.

My fogs USED to light up the sides a little bit, but I disaseembled my headlights, and cleaned the projectors. They were kinda hazy and dusty, even htough they looked fine from outside of hte car. Once I reinstalled, along with some higher wattege bubls for the projectors, the fogs are completley useless unless it's actually foggy. I've driven in a few other svsx where the fogs also do nothing, because hte projectors are so powerful and accurate.

Again, there must be something wrong with your headlights.
